On Fri, 2015-03-27 at 13:35 +0200, Peter Ujfalusi wrote: > The vd->node is removed from the lists when the transfer started so the > vchan_get_all_descriptors() will not find it. This results memory leak. > > Signed-off-by: Peter Ujfalusi <peter.ujfalusi@ti.com> > CC: Andy Shevchenko <andriy.shevchenko@linux.intel.com> > --- > drivers/dma/hsu/hsu.c | 5 ++++- > 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-) > > diff --git a/drivers/dma/hsu/hsu.c b/drivers/dma/hsu/hsu.c > index 683ba9b62795..d1864bda008f 100644 > --- a/drivers/dma/hsu/hsu.c > +++ b/drivers/dma/hsu/hsu.c > @@ -387,7 +387,10 @@ static int hsu_dma_terminate_all(struct dma_chan *chan) > spin_lock_irqsave(&hsuc->vchan.lock, flags); > > hsu_dma_stop_channel(hsuc); > - hsuc->desc = NULL; > + if (hsuc->desc) { > + hsu_dma_desc_free(&hsuc->desc->vchan);
By the way, it should be 'vdesc);' at the end.
> + hsuc->desc = NULL; > + } > > vchan_get_all_descriptors(&hsuc->vchan, &head); > spin_unlock_irqrestore(&hsuc->vchan.lock, flags);
